Summary of Roof Products



As home owners increasingly prioritize sturdiness and power effectiveness, comprehending the numerous roof covering products readily available for substitute ends up being important. The choice of roofing products directly affects not just the visual charm of a home yet likewise its long-term performance and upkeep prices.


Amongst the most common roof covering materials are asphalt roof shingles, metal roofing, and tile. Asphalt roof shingles are preferred for their price and ease of installment, making them a prominent choice for several property applications. Metal roof, that includes products such as steel and light weight aluminum, uses remarkable longevity and power performance, commonly reflecting heat and reducing cooling costs. Tile roof, commonly made from clay or concrete, is treasured for its long life and aesthetic allure, supplying a distinctive appearance that can enhance a home's worth.


Furthermore, newer materials such as synthetic shingles and environment-friendly roof covering systems are obtaining grip. Synthetic options imitate standard products while providing improved sturdiness and lower maintenance needs. Environment-friendly roofings, which include plant life, add to power performance and biodiversity.


Resilience Analysis



When examining roof covering materials for substitute, longevity is an important element that homeowners have to consider. The lifespan and strength of roof covering products directly affect long-lasting upkeep and substitute prices. Various products show differing levels of toughness, making it vital to understand their efficiency under environmental stress factors.


Asphalt roof shingles, while popular for their cost-effectiveness, commonly last 15 to three decades and may need even more regular replacement because of degeneration from UV direct exposure and severe climate. In contrast, steel roof covering provides amazing sturdiness, with a lifespan of 40 to 70 years and resistance to wind, fire, and insects. Additionally, clay and concrete ceramic tiles can withstand rough problems, often outlasting half a century, although their weight necessitates a durable structural assistance system.

Expense Comparison



Thinking about the monetary implications of roof covering materials is crucial for house owners preparing a substitute. The expense of roof covering products can vary significantly based on factors such as product type, installation complexity, and local prices distinctions.


Asphalt tiles are among one of the most affordable options, typically varying from $90 to $100 per square (100 square feet), making them a preferred selection for budget-conscious house owners. In comparison, metal roofing can set you back in between $250 and $700 per square, depending upon the kind of steel and surface chosen. While steel roofing systems often tend to have a higher upfront cost, their durability and power performance may result in expense financial savings in time.


Clay and concrete ceramic tiles are also on the greater end of the spectrum, averaging between $300 and $600 per square. These materials provide toughness and aesthetic allure however require a considerable preliminary investment.


Finally, slate roofing, understood for its outstanding sturdiness and timeless appearance, can vary from $600 to $1,500 per square, making it one of the most expensive alternative. Home owners have to consider the first expenses versus the anticipated life-span and upkeep needs of each material to make an informed choice.
